Jubilee Line railway between Canons Park and Stanmore
Viewed from the bridge carrying the access track across the railway in Canons Park, the Du Cros Drive / Dalkeith Grove road bridge is visible in the distance, and Stanmore station is beyond that. The line opened in 1932 as a branch of the Metropolitan Line from Wembley Park. In 1939 operation of the railway was taken over by the Bakerloo Line, and, after a short-lived period when it was known as the Fleet Line, the new Jubilee Line took over operations in 1979.
